Frequently Asked Questions


In some cases, vitamin D3 is prescribed to be taken once a week to improve compliance with treatment plans, especially for individuals who have difficulty adhering to daily regimens. This approach can also be effective for certain medical conditions.

You can purchase over-the-counter vitamin D3 supplements, but it's advisable to consult a healthcare provider before starting any supplementation, especially if you have underlying medical conditions or concerns about dosage. Professional guidance ensures safe and effective use.

Vitamin D deficiency may be associated with anxiety in some cases, but it is not a direct cause of anxiety. Maintaining adequate vitamin D levels through supplementation or sunlight exposure may help alleviate some anxiety-related symptoms, but it's not a guaranteed cure for anxiety disorders.

Vitamin D3 can influence mood regulation, and addressing deficiency may help alleviate symptoms of low mood. However, it's not a guaranteed mood changer, and its effects on mood can vary among individuals.
